Hyderabad, Jun 24: While the whole is nation desperately debating over escalating corruption in the country,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ister Kiran Kumar Reddy has asked his Cabinet colleagues to submit their property list by Aug 31, 2011.

The new move by the Andra CM was followed by Prime Minister Manmohan Singh's decision to ask the Union Cabinet ministers to provide a list of their properties by Aug 31.

Interestingly, some of the state cabinet ministers on Thursday, Jun 23 said that they were not aware about Chief Ministers order to submit their property returns. Some of them added that they came to know about the matter only when school education minister Sailajanath spoke about it to the media.

"The CM has asked all of us to submit our property returns by August 31. I am preparing to give it by July 15 itself," said Sailajanath.

Sources close to CMs office said that the order has been sent by the General Administration Department to all ministers' office.

Even though some of the ministers favoured CM's decision, others were silently opposing it. When it comes to declaring personal assets, it's obvious that the team opposing the new move will get majority. Some ministers were cross checking with their personal staff to know about the 'letter form CM office'.
